ON THE CRYOGENIC ASPECTS OF PROJECT SHERWOOD. Fifth Progress Report, January 1, 1961 to March 31, 1961

The superconductivity of a Nb/sub 2/Sn wire was studied in pulsed magnetic fields of 185 kilogauss, and the critical field was found to be approximately 188 kilogauss at 1.6 deg K. Electrical resistivity measurements are reported for high-purity Al. The status of refrigeration cycle analysis is described. The turbo-expander, for use in a He refrigeration system, was tested and its gas-lubricated bearings found stable at operation up to 7 kw refrigeration. (D.L.C.)
